Positron's next-gen Azimov chip uses commodity LPDDR memory to deliver 2.3TB per chip at 400W — 6-8x the memory capacity of Nvidia's B200 at a quarter of the power — while its systolic array achieves a 1:1 matrix-matrix to matrix-vector ratio versus Nvidia's 32:1, enabling far more efficient inference scaling for trillion-parameter models.
Nvidia's architectural focus on dense matrix-matrix training workloads caused the matrix-vector performance ratio to degrade from 16:1 on Hopper to 32:1 on Blackwell, even as total flops doubled — a structural disadvantage for inference where attention mechanisms are memory-bound matrix-vector operations.
